When selecting a programming laptop for students, several factors can influence your experience and future-proofing. Understanding these will help you avoid common pitfalls and make smarter decisions based on your specific needs and budget.Processor Power and Speed
The CPU is the heart of a programming laptop; faster processors like AMD Ryzen 7 and Intel Core i5/i7 handle compiling, multitasking, and running virtual machines more efficiently. Students working on complex projects or multiple applications should prioritize higher-end CPUs, but for basic coding and web development, mid-range processors are sufficient. Remember, a faster CPU also helps in future-proofing your device as coding environments become more demanding.
Memory (RAM) Capacity
16GB of RAM is generally a good baseline for most student programmers, allowing for smooth multitasking and running IDEs alongside browsers and other tools. However, if you plan to work on large datasets, Android emulators, or virtual machines, opting for 32GB can significantly improve performance. Avoid laptops with less than 8GB RAM, as they can bottleneck your workflows and cause frustration during intensive tasks.
Portability and Battery Life
Students need to carry their laptops across campus, so weight and battery life matter. Lighter models under 4 pounds make mobility easier, but might compromise on screen size or performance. Conversely, larger screens enhance coding comfort but add weight. Prioritize laptops with good battery life—ideally over 8 hours—to avoid constant charging during long classes or study sessions.
Display Quality and Size
A clear, comfortable display reduces eye strain during long coding sessions. Full HD resolution (1920×1080) is standard and sufficient for most needs. Larger screens, like 15.6 or 17 inches, improve visibility but may reduce portability. Consider an IPS panel for better color accuracy and viewing angles, especially if you plan to do design work or use multiple windows side-by-side.
Build Quality and Keyboard Comfort
Durability matters when a laptop is frequently transported, so look for models with sturdy chassis. The keyboard’s feel is also critical for long coding sessions; a responsive, well-spaced keyboard with good key travel can reduce fatigue. Some laptops include backlit keyboards, which are helpful in dim environments. Skipping these features can lead to discomfort and reduced productivity over time.
Price and Upgradeability
While budget options can meet basic needs, investing in a slightly more expensive model often provides better longevity and performance. Check if the laptop allows upgrades like additional RAM or storage, which can extend its usefulness as your coding demands grow. Be wary of models with non-upgradable components, as they might limit future performance improvements.
